It’s a question that many small business owners often ask themselves, and the answer is simple: manual invoicing is a time-consuming, long and tedious process that consumes a lot of resources. Especially in professional offices such as lawyers, consultants or accountants, careful management of invoicing is essential, as it is through invoicing that the services rendered are charged for. 

For this and many other reasons, good billing software is essential to ensure that the billing process is efficient, accurate and error-free, which can translate into increased profitability.  

There are several invoicing programs on the market that are designed specifically for professional offices and not only automate the invoicing process, but also offer tools for client management, payment tracking and financial reporting. 

Read on to find out what the main features of these software products are, what advantages they can bring to your business and why you should use them.

Essential features in invoicing software for consultancies and firms

If you are looking for an invoicing programme for your office, there are certain fundamental characteristics that you should take in consideration. Here are the four most important ones:

Invoice customisation

First of all, it is necessary that the invoicing software for professional offices allows you to customize invoices, including the insertion of logos, colors and fonts. This is so that the invoices are consistent with the firm’s branding and make a good impression on clients. 

Client management

Next, the invoicing software should allow for customer management, including the storage of detailed customer information. This will make it easier to track invoices, identify delinquent customers and send payment reminders.

Payment tracking

Payment tracking is a key feature in an invoicing software that should allow the recording of payments, the identification of delinquent customers and the sending of automatic payment reminders. 

Financial reporting

In the end, it is important that billing software allows for financial reporting, including information on dispatch performance, cash flow and revenue.


How to choose the best invoicing software for your professional office?

Well, now that we have listed the fundamental features that an invoicing software should have, let’s see what are the factors to consider when you are choosing an invoicing software for your office: 

  • – Ease of use;
  • – The scalability of the software;
  • – The cost of the software and the functionalities it offers;
  • – Integration with other financial management tools;
  • – The security of the firm’s data;


Of course, it is also important to take the time to research the available options and carefully evaluate each software before making a final decision.

Benefits of using professional office management software

If you are still wondering how these software can improve your business, below you will find a series of the main benefits that can really make a difference to the profitability of your professional office. Here it is:

Task automation

The invoicing process, as mentioned above, can be tedious and time consuming; with good professional management software you can automate many repetitive tasks and simplify the process, saving time and resources for the firm, and more importantly to concentrate on other areas of your business. 

This can include creating invoices, tracking client payments, inventory management, bookkeeping and much more. 

Improving accuracy and reducing errors

Professional management software can significantly reduce human error by automating complex processes and simplifying tasks that would otherwise be difficult to perform manually. This means your financial records will be more accurate and you will have fewer problems when filing tax returns and other financial documents.

Increased efficiency and productivity

Finally, by automating tasks and reducing errors, professional management software can significantly improve the efficiency and productivity of your law firm. This allows you to focus on the tasks that are really important to your business and improve client satisfaction by providing a faster and more efficient service, while also reducing the risk of disputes or conflicts.



Why tools like Bounsel Flow can help you manage your law firm?

Therefore, a contract management and automation software like Bounsel Flow is necessary to improve your work because it can bring the advantages and benefits we’ve just talked about. In fact, Bounsel Flow can help you create documents in seconds through conversational forms, all in a more fun and human way. So you can say goodbye to repetitive tasks and “copy and paste”.

legal design

Frequently Asked Questions

What are free and licensed software?

There are many invoicing programs available on the market, some are free and some are paid.

In addition, billing software can be divided into two categories, free and licensed software; let’s look at the differences between them!

The fist is software that is distributed without restrictions on its use, copying, modification and distribution. Free software invoicing programs are completely free and can be modified and customized according to the company’s needs. Also, the community of free software developers is very active, which means that there are many constant updates and improvements available for the program. 

On the other hand, licensed invoicing programs are those that are sold with a license and are subject to certain restrictions on their use, copying and distribution. Paid billing software usually offers additional features and more comprehensive technical support.

Do these types of software use artificial intelligence?

Artificial intelligence is used to automate and improve billing processes, allowing users to save time and resources; so yes, some do. 

For example, some billing software can use artificial intelligence to analyze data and predict the amount of cash expected to be received in a certain period of time. AI can also be used to automate error detection and correction. 


In conclusion, having the right invoicing software is nowadays essential for any professional firm. Invoicing software offers tools to automate the invoicing process, as well as for client management, payment tracking and financial reporting. 

Whether you opt for a free or licensed software programme, make sure it meets your needs and helps you achieve your business goals so you can focus on what really matters: providing quality services to your clients.